Why Choose a Sleeping Bag with a Two-Way Zipper?
Opting for a sleeping bag with a two-way zipper can significantly improve your camping experience. Here are the key benefits:
- Temperature Control: Two-way zippers allow you to open the sleeping bag from the top or bottom, providing adjustable ventilation to regulate temperature.
- Ease of Access: You can unzip the bag from the bottom to free your feet or create an opening for movement without exposing your upper body to the cold.
- Versatility: These sleeping bags can be fully unzipped to use as a blanket or to pair with another sleeping bag for shared warmth.
- Convenience: The two-way zipper design simplifies getting in and out of the sleeping bag, especially when nature calls at night.
How Does a Two-Way Zipper Enhance Temperature Control?
Temperature regulation is crucial for a comfortable night’s sleep, especially in varying outdoor conditions. Here’s how a two-way zipper helps:
- Ventilation: By unzipping from the bottom, you can allow cooler air to circulate without compromising your upper body warmth.
- Foot Vent: In warmer climates, opening the bottom allows for foot ventilation, reducing overheating.
- Customizable Warmth: Adjust the zipper to your preference, maintaining optimal warmth and comfort throughout the night.

How to Choose the Right Sleeping Bag with a Two-Way Zipper?
When selecting a sleeping bag, consider the following factors:
- Climate: Choose a bag with a temperature rating suitable for your camping environment.
- Weight: For backpacking, opt for a lightweight model to reduce your load.
- Material: Consider durability and comfort; ripstop materials offer increased resistance to wear and tear.
- Budget: Balance features with cost to find the best value for your needs.
